Output df591fffe16a68ef141041dd0c16d5e37d3086f12b82b705dc835f7c4e1a742c:16

value
5265020
script pubkey
OP_HASH160 OP_PUSHBYTES_20 538c7156e49a4e618e26ec16796913cec4428600 OP_EQUAL
address
39JnFbdBTHQWaNfMey8knDZXjXuEySFoYc
transaction
df591fffe16a68ef141041dd0c16d5e37d3086f12b82b705dc835f7c4e1a742c
spent
true